StopTalkingAutoBan
A NEW VERSION STAB IS NOW AVAILABLE, PLEASE DOWNLOAD IT HERE
ANY VERSION BELOW Alpha 2 is NOT supported. So please do not submit bug reports if you are on a version LOWER than Alpha2==
All older commands (excluding reload and mute are now supported). As well as STAB being much faster than ever before!
This plugin was developed specifically to stop spam on your server as fast and efficient as possible.
STAB is fully configurable. Ranging to from the messages that are sent to the user upon kick or ban, to tweaking the sensitivity of STAB.
Currently by default, all builders get 1 offence for spamming. If that offence is used up, they will be banned from the server on their next offence. (Warnings may be turned off in the plugins config file)
STAB also features it's own Remote Console system. Allowing admin to watch their servers from home without having to deal with pesky SSH or Command Line! Just simply type the Server IP and stabRcon port number and hit connect! You will now be able to send commands, see who's currently logged in, chat in game, and kick/ban players, without ever logging into Minecraft!
Features:
- Logs the IPs and Usernames of every player that joins.
- Logs the chatlog with DisplayName and AccountName.
- Watches each player individually for both Chat and Command Spamming
- Lag Calibration/Anti-Lag
- Intelligent system for detecting players that spam in game.
- Fully Multi-threaded
- Lots of configuration options to make the experience perfect for your server.
- Easy to use both in-game, and in console.
- Permissions support, but not required.
- MCBans Support
- PlayerLogging
- Remote Console
- On-The-Fly Editing of Configuration Options
Links:
If you enjoy this plugin, feel free to click the button below. Doing this will allow me to continue development and support each build. Any amount is GREATLY appreciated, even if its $1...
.png)

-
View User Profile
-
Send Message
Posted Apr 6, 2012@CoWs_they_go_moo
This weekend.
-
View User Profile
-
Send Message
Posted Apr 6, 2012When is a update coming for this?
Thanks, Aaron. :)
-
View User Profile
-
Send Message
Posted Apr 5, 2012@Enrux
Coming in next release!
-
View User Profile
-
Send Message
Posted Apr 4, 2012I think it would also be great to add the possibility to make kickeable words or phrases
-
View User Profile
-
Send Message
Posted Apr 3, 2012@VariousArtist
Please PM me or add me on Skype.
@darkcloud784
That is strange, please add me on Skype so we can figure out the issue. I'm starting to think there might be a conflict with another plugin, or something wrong with Java on your machine.
-
View User Profile
-
Send Message
Posted Apr 2, 2012@blackburn29
I'm actually on the 1.2.4 RB NOT the beta. I've also noticed that on reboot it will "save players and shut down the server" which freezes the server. I have to manually kill java then restart the server.
-
View User Profile
-
Send Message
Posted Apr 2, 2012Blackburn, while STAB was helpful a lot of times to prevent those idiotic chat spammings Ive noticed that theres another feature I find even more useful on our PvP server: The IP logging.
On a PvP server the usage of alt accounts can offer a lot of exploits, so we are usually on the lookout for them and the IP logging of STAB was pretty helpful.
Although, it could be expanded. I would love to have an overview which accounts share the same IP - not only the logged in players, but also in the past. STABs logging also helped us to track down a few of the stupid griefing groups, that tried to swamp our servers with over 30-40 bogus accounts. The IP tracking was most helpful to make their attempts a massive failure and expand our banlists with a few more trophies.
Maybe you want to think about expanding STAB more into that direction. In my humble opinion theres a need for such features.
cheers! Keep up the good work!
-
View User Profile
-
Send Message
Posted Apr 1, 2012@darkcloud784
Please be aware that most bukkit builds out right now are beta builds for a reason. They DO have issues. Especially with plugins. STAB is a very effecient plugin, but can be resource heavy depending on the number of players on the server. My next update (comes out tonight more than likely changes a few things to help give a performance boost, as well as a few bugfixes)
-
View User Profile
-
Send Message
Posted Mar 31, 2012@xizvyrious
yes we use CB Plus Plus 1.2.4 but as always I also make sure it observes the same behavior on the regular CB RB's. Which it does.
-
View User Profile
-
Send Message
Posted Mar 31, 2012@darkcloud784
We will look into this but STAB v2.0.5 is fully multithreaded and should cause no lag... have you updated to Bukkit's Recommended Build for 1.2.4?
-
View User Profile
-
Send Message
Posted Mar 30, 2012STAB v2.0.5
Seems to lag my sever. With 2.0.4r I was getting 20tps no hickups. Now I get 18.6 and sometimes hickups to 16.4 on someones logging in or typing.
-
View User Profile
-
Send Message
Posted Mar 29, 2012I apologize for the lack of updates recently. I have been extremely sick this week, and have been slammed with tests now that I am no longer on spring break. I hope to push something out soon, as well as a few other plugins I've been working on.
Thanks and sorry again, Blackburn
-
View User Profile
-
Send Message
Posted Mar 27, 2012@kotpx3
Yes STAB v2.0.4r is compatible with Bukkit's 1.2.4 builds.
-
View User Profile
-
Send Message
Posted Mar 27, 2012Is this updated to 1.2.4?
-
View User Profile
-
Send Message
Posted Mar 12, 2012@rebel24
That's more than likely your issue. It seems to be hit or miss with mChat... STAB DOES work with HeroChat though!
-
View User Profile
-
Send Message
Posted Mar 10, 2012mchat :P
-
View User Profile
-
Send Message
Posted Mar 4, 2012@rebel24
what chat plugins are you running? I just tested STAB with the LATEST dev build for 1.2.3 and did not have any issues.
-
View User Profile
-
Send Message
Posted Mar 4, 2012@codydbgt
Been working on fixing this for the next release.... Its an issue with IP Logging. If you dont use IP Logs, disable them and this error 'should' disappear.
-
View User Profile
-
Send Message
Posted Mar 4, 2012works for me just get a error when they join some times :P
12:29:20 [SEVERE] Could not pass event PlayerJoinEvent to StopTalkingAutoBan
org.bukkit.event.EventException
at org.bukkit.plugin.java.JavaPluginLoader$1.execute(JavaPluginLoader.ja
va:303)
at org.bukkit.plugin.RegisteredListener.callEvent(RegisteredListener.jav
a:62)
at org.bukkit.plugin.SimplePluginManager.callEvent(SimplePluginManager.j
ava:441)
at net.minecraft.server.ServerConfigurationManager.c(ServerConfiguration
Manager.java:132
at net.minecraft.server.NetLoginHandler.b(NetLoginHandler.java:121)
at net.minecraft.server.NetLoginHandler.a(NetLoginHandler.java:87)
at net.minecraft.server.Packet1Login.handle(SourceFile:68)
at net.minecraft.server.NetworkManager.b(NetworkManager.java:229)
at net.minecraft.server.NetLoginHandler.a(NetLoginHandler.java:47)
at net.minecraft.server.NetworkListenThread.a(NetworkListenThread.java:6
1)
at net.minecraft.server.MinecraftServer.w(MinecraftServer.java:554)
at net.minecraft.server.MinecraftServer.run(MinecraftServer.java:452)
at net.minecraft.server.ThreadServerApplication.run(SourceFile:490)
Caused by: java.lang.NullPointerException
at me.blackburn.STAB.stabPlayerListener.onPlayerJoin(stabPlayerListener.
java:163)
at sun.reflect.GeneratedMethodAccessor211.invoke(Unknown Source)
at sun.reflect.DelegatingMethodAccessorImpl.invoke(Unknown Source)
at java.lang.reflect.Method.invoke(Unknown Source)
at org.bukkit.plugin.java.JavaPluginLoader$1.execute(JavaPluginLoader.ja
va:301)
... 12 more
-
View User Profile
-
Send Message
Posted Mar 4, 2012@xizvyrious
Nope, nothing mate. Nothing shows, it loads but thats it, i'm on the beta of 1.2. Which works awesomely!